  • Designing Revenue

    by Richard Banfield

    Designing Revenue is an intensive, half-day course for Founders, Executives, Investors, & Decision-Makers on creating and managing UX/UI design to encourage engagement, deepen loyalty, and drive revenues.

    Richard Banfield, CEO & Co Founder of leading UI design firm Fresh Tilled Soil, will guide you through the optimal roadmap for designing web and mobile products that connect functionally and emotionally to your target audiences. You will learn how to take an idea from concept to design, architect the user experience, create the details for the design, and validate the interface through various testing methodologies.

    No Photoshop or Fireworks are needed. This is a management-focused workshop to give you the tools to successfully direct your product development plan through the user-centric design process.

  • HTML CSS Essentials & Mastery: Refining Skills From Design To Code

    by Michael Connors

    This is a 2 (consecutive) day workshop targeted for Web Designers, Graphic Designers, Developers, Marketers, & those looking to sharpen their skill set & knowledge of HTML5/CSS3.

    This course is a real-world, skills-based workshop that provides essential knowledge of HTML5 and CSS3, both in theory and practical application. If you are self-taught, have limited formal training in HTML/CSS, still confused about best practices, just faking it, frustrated with code, or still don’t quite “get it,” this course is perfect for you.

    On day one, we begin by discussing and reviewing HTML and CSS basics in a way you may have never looked at them before – we'll be shedding new light on core concepts, covering best practices for using structural elements, semantics, page structure, and how HTML and CSS work together to control page presentation.

    On day two, we work on a hands-on project lab, where students apply what they’ve learned to first create wireframes of a web page, and then a visual prototype using Fireworks or Photoshop. Lastly, students will code the design, applying best practice workflow techniques.
